Verdict: Massey Ferguson 3070 vs Massey Ferguson 5611

The Massey Ferguson 3070 and the Massey Ferguson 5611 are both tractors — here is how they stack up on the figures that matter. Both are rated at the same 80 hp. Massey Ferguson 5611 is the lighter machine (8,929 kg vs 9,652 kg), which helps on soft ground and transport, while the heavier model carries more ballast for traction-limited draft work. Massey Ferguson 5611 is the newer design (2013 vs 1986). Use the full side-by-side spec tables below to weigh the details against your own operation, and confirm with a dealer demo.
